MTH 443 Boundary Value Problems for Engineers

Semester:
Fall of every year
Credits:
Total Credits: Credits: 3   Lecture/Recitation/Discussion Hours:3
Prerequisite:
MTH 235 or MTH 255H or LBS 220
Restrictions:
Not open to students in the Department of Mathematics.
Description:
Fourier series and orthogonal functions, method of separation of variables for partial differential equations, Sturm-Liouville problems.
Effective Dates:
FS99 - FS07
